Tiello has partnered with a highly regarded and growing Structural Steel Fabricator with locations across the Midwest, Mid Atlantic, Northeast and Southeast on the search for an Onsite/Traveling Project Manager with experience overseeing $50M+ structural steel projects in various locations across the United States but more specifically, to support the East Coast and Midwest Projects.
Key Responsibilities:- Interact daily & continuously with erection foreman to assist with coordination of materials,laydown/logistics, supply needs, etc.
- Set up and re-schedule deliveries with all steel shops, joist & deck, bolts (follow up with emails to vendors and cc office PM)
- Attend weekly/daily meetings with the erector
- Review deliveries of steel and immediately starts coordinating with company and other fabrication shop(s) if anything is missing to resolve & expedite missing pieces
- Works with erector to resolve fix for any mis-fabricated and/or mis-detailed pieces to keep erection going.
- Immediately after includes in-office PM with details to document issue(s).
- Look ahead at concrete progress, anchor bolts, surveys of anchor bolts, crane and access roads, etc.
- Coordinate with erector and contractor to prepare site for our work, coordinate with other trades
- Ensure erector addresses all inspection items and remedies timely
- Reviews & maintains rolling punch list
- Relays any changes in the field/directives from customer to in-office PM for recording.
- Reviews erector time tickets for extra work to be submitted
- Works minimum 5 days a week with erector during their work hours, follows all on site Safety requirements.
- Works overtime as required by the erection crew within confines of agreement with company management.
- Reviews and analyzes manpower requirements and schedule progress.
- Observe safety measures in place by erector and ensures OSHA, contractor and company requirements are met.
- Communicate clearly and respectfully on behalf of company to the contractor and other parties
- Participates in pre-planning including sequencing, schedules, delivery timing, site coordination, joins pre-erection meetings with erector & contractor
